    2012-11-26 BCR Blastoise 031

    Awesome ability (can attach to any pokemon); great weakness; terrific hit points - what's not to love? Retreat cost is painful, but when paired with Keldeo Ex, it's almost irrelevant. 9/10

    2011-11-25 NV Kyurem 034

    Kyurem is just too good with eviolite to keep him alive - play the spread until you have to go for Outrage; combine him with Reshiram to take care of weakness (and Chansey) as well as Electrode Prime to accelerate the energies. 8/10

    2011-10-14 EP Cheren 091

    Fairly useless in a basic or stage 1 deck where Juniper or Sages provide much more speed. Can be essential (especially if paired with Research Record) in a stage 2 deck where you just need that candy or Stage 2 pokemon to get going, but I'm inclined to go with Engineers instead 6/10
